LG Uplus "Complex Cultural Space 'Teum' Gaining Spotlight as Communication Channel for MZ Generation"
[Asia Economy Reporter Kim Heung-soon] LG Uplus announced on the 8th that the complex cultural space 'Ilsangbi Ilsang-ui Teum (Teum)' in Gangnam, Seoul, is gaining attention as a new communication space for the MZ generation. Certification shots and voluntary experience stories from MZ generation visitors to Teum have become a hot topic on social networking services (SNS), leading to a continuous stream of inquiries from media and planning companies.
LG Uplus held a contactless (untact) lecture for the MZ generation titled "Changing everyday life in my own way" on the 28th of last month at Teum, called '15 Minutes to Change the World' (hereafter Sebasi). The lecture was conducted live via Zoom and YouTube. Five speakers who have recently captivated the MZ generation appeared: rapper Jo Gwang-il, Taejae, an independent bookstore operator and author of Storybook & Film, Miss Korea and Kabaddi national representative Woo Hee-jun, 'Rapping Teacher' Dalji, and fashion & beauty creator Hazel.
The speakers shared their experiences of setting their own life direction and practicing toward success according to the MZ generation’s representative keyword 'My-sider' (My-sider: setting and following one’s own standards). LG Uplus stated, "The cumulative number of lecture attendees exceeded 16,500, marking the highest record among all Sebasi untact lectures." This video can be viewed again on the Sebasi YouTube channel (www.youtube.com/user/cbs15min).
On the 3rd, filming was conducted at Teum upon the request of the Seoul Tourism Foundation and KBS 2TV for a new entertainment program introducing Seoul’s tourist attractions called 'Play Seoul.' Teum was introduced as a rising playground for the MZ generation and a space for healing and recharging with unique content on each floor. Additionally, on the 29th of last month at 11 p.m., the Apple iPhone 12 launch event 'Teummanneum Z Mamdaero' was also held at Teum.
